Transaction 0a66cbd9eaaf07b5391ff3c4720004363421156ff7c8abc45f41993320c98196
1 Input
1 Output
-
0a66cbd9eaaf07b5391ff3c4720004363421156ff7c8abc45f41993320c98196:0
- value
- 417946
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5284a51d444a0d3f27eeadccde18614068610717 OP_EQUAL
- address
- 39DLEcFBYh5Aee4dMNz12afkJKeAUa24mT